ABSTRACT
The title of this Study is “English Teaching for Elementary School
Students at SD No.1 Mengwitani”. This study aimed at investigating how the teacher taught his/her students in the class and the details of what kinds of approaches, methods, and techniques that are used in teaching fifth grade students. This study also aimed at discovering the difficulties that were faced by the teacher in teaching English for the fifth grade school students.
The data were collected by documentation, observation, and interview techniques that were conducted in SD No.1 Mengwitani. The collected data analyzed by qualitative methods. It also identified and analyzed based on a theory proposed by Richards and Rodgers on their book Approaches, Methods in Language Teaching (1992).
The results show that the English teacher of SD No.1 Mengwitani used communicative approach in the class to build up the students’ confidence in using English. The methods that were used by the English teacher during the teaching- learning process are translation method and audio-lingual method. The techniques that were used by the English teacher in the class Imitation (choral imitation and individual imitation), drilling, reading a text, and translating some sentences. Games and songs also applied during teaching- learning process as teaching aids.
